David the most popular options seem to be the Maxijet 900 or 1200. I have read that the Rio 4HF and 6HF will fit. The Rio seems to have a higher flow rate and less power draw. I have not tested them so I do not know for sure they would fit, but reading on another forum I know the 4HF fits and i believe I saw some posts saying the 6HF fits as well.

Quick question for you guys,how is the lighting on a stock 28 gal. I'm thinking of buy one for my first saltwater tank
 
Bodiddley, clams probably aren't the best idea for the BC under stock lighting. You could keep a derasa, but they get HUGE. Puggsli1, the lighting is average at best, only good for softies or LPS mostly. I have heard about that jkrentz, I thought it was a myth! Awesome look. Puggsli1, that's what you need! :)
